Honored Fleet Owner Editor-in-Chief Jim Mele takes on new role as editor emeritus, while Sean Kilcarr named successor to lead new era of engagement
STAMFORD, CT. Fleet Owner, the trucking industry’s leading information source for more than 90 years, will see its long-time Editor-in-Chief Jim Mele step into the role of editor emeritus on May 5, and current Executive Editor Sean Kilcarr will take on the editor-in-chief role.
